Bachelor of Pharmacy is
a Four year degree program designed to impart profound pharmaceutical
knowledge through quality research and training programs to cater the
community health needs thereby facilitating the development of socially
responsible pharmacists and entrepreneurs. The course of study for B.
Pharm shall extend over a period of eight semesters (four academic
years) and six semesters (three academic years) for lateral entry
students. The B Pharmacy course is duly approved by the Pharmacy Council
of India, New Delhi, and the Department of Higher Education, Haryana.
The curriculum of B. Pharm includes an in-depth study of the fur major
specialization of Pharmacy namely Pharmaceutics, Pharmacology,
Pharmaceutical Chemistry, and Pharmacognosy.

Admission Requirements
50+
The following are the eligibility
Criteria for admission in B Pharmacy courses for both National and
International Students (4-year):
The candidate should attain the age of 17
years or more on 31-12-2024.The age shall be determined as per entry in
the Matriculation/Secondary school or its equivalent examination
certificate.
Candidate shall have passed 10+2
examination conducted by the respective State/ Central Government
authorities recognized as equivalent to 10+2 examination by the
Association of Indian Universities (AIU) with English as one of the
subjects and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ics (P.C.M.) and or Biology
(P.C.B/P.C.B.M.) as optional subjects individually.
Any other qualification approved by the Pharmacy Council of India equivalent to any of the above examinations.
Minimum Academic Qualifications for B. Pharmacy (in 2nd year through Lateral Entry):
If you are a D.Pharm holder and want to
join the B Pharmacy courses in GD Goenka University, you can apply for
direct admission to B.Pharm 2nd year shall pass those subjects of
B.Pharm Ist year which are not covered under D.Pharm.
Process for admissions as prescribed by
Haryana State Technical Education Society (HSTES)/ Pharmacy Council of
India (PCI) is strictly followed for admission in B. Pharmacy programs.
Students should explore the website www.hstes.org.in for the detailed
admission process through centralized counseling.
